+"""Tests for the ``changes/`` fragment generator in ``tools/changes.py``."""
+
+import importlib.util
+from pathlib import Path
+
+_REPO_ROOT = Path(__file__).parent.parent.parent
+_GENERATOR_PATH = _REPO_ROOT / "tools" / "changes.py"
+
+
+def _load_generator():
+ spec = importlib.util.spec_from_file_location("edify_changes_tool", _GENERATOR_PATH)
+ assert spec is not None
+ assert spec.loader is not None
+ module = importlib.util.module_from_spec(spec)
+ spec.loader.exec_module(module)
+ return module
+
+
+_GENERATOR = _load_generator()
+
+
+def _write_fragment(directory: Path, name: str, body: str) -> Path:
+ fragment_path = directory / name
+ fragment_path.write_text(body, encoding="utf-8")
+ return fragment_path
+
+
+def test_collect_fragments_returns_files_in_fragment_id_order(tmp_path):
+ _write_fragment(tmp_path, "0020-second.rst", "[change]\nanchor=b\nheading=B\ncontext=b")
+ _write_fragment(tmp_path, "0010-first.rst", "[change]\nanchor=a\nheading=A\ncontext=a")
+ collected = _GENERATOR.collect_fragments(tmp_path)
+ assert [path.name for path in collected] == ["0010-first.rst", "0020-second.rst"]
+
+
+def test_collect_fragments_skips_the_readme(tmp_path):
+ _write_fragment(tmp_path, "README.rst", "not a fragment")
+ _write_fragment(tmp_path, "0010-only.rst", "[change]\nanchor=a\nheading=A\ncontext=a")
+ collected = _GENERATOR.collect_fragments(tmp_path)
+ assert [path.name for path in collected] == ["0010-only.rst"]
+
+
+def test_render_fragment_emits_anchor_heading_and_context(tmp_path):
+ fragment_path = _write_fragment(
+ tmp_path,
+ "0010-example.rst",
+ "[change]\nanchor = my-anchor\nheading = My Heading\ncontext = A single sentence.",
+ )
+ rendered = _GENERATOR.render_fragment(fragment_path)
+ assert ".. _my-anchor:" in rendered
+ assert "My Heading" in rendered
+ assert "-" * len("My Heading") in rendered
+ assert "A single sentence." in rendered
+
+
+def test_render_fragment_collapses_multiline_context_into_one_paragraph(tmp_path):
+ fragment_path = _write_fragment(
+ tmp_path,
+ "0010-multiline.rst",
+ "[change]\nanchor = a\nheading = H\ncontext = first line\n second line",
+ )
+ rendered = _GENERATOR.render_fragment(fragment_path)
+ assert "first line second line" in rendered
+
+
+def test_render_fragment_includes_before_after_block_when_both_present(tmp_path):
+ fragment_path = _write_fragment(
+ tmp_path,
+ "0010-beforeafter.rst",
+ "[change]\nanchor = a\nheading = H\nbefore = old\nafter = new\ncontext = changed",
+ )
+ rendered = _GENERATOR.render_fragment(fragment_path)
+ assert ".. code-block:: text" in rendered
+ assert " old" in rendered
+ assert " new" in rendered
+
+
+def test_render_fragment_omits_before_after_block_when_absent(tmp_path):
+ fragment_path = _write_fragment(
+ tmp_path,
+ "0010-nofix.rst",
+ "[change]\nanchor = a\nheading = H\ncontext = no before/after here",
+ )
+ rendered = _GENERATOR.render_fragment(fragment_path)
+ assert ".. code-block:: text" not in rendered
+
+
+def test_render_all_concatenates_every_fragment_in_order(tmp_path):
+ _write_fragment(tmp_path, "0020-b.rst", "[change]\nanchor=b\nheading=Bravo\ncontext=b")
+ _write_fragment(tmp_path, "0010-a.rst", "[change]\nanchor=a\nheading=Alpha\ncontext=a")
+ rendered = _GENERATOR.render_all(tmp_path)
+ assert rendered.index("Alpha") < rendered.index("Bravo")
+
+
+def test_main_release_deletes_consumed_fragments(tmp_path, monkeypatch):
+ _write_fragment(tmp_path, "0010-a.rst", "[change]\nanchor=a\nheading=A\ncontext=a")
+ monkeypatch.setattr(_GENERATOR, "_CHANGES_DIR", tmp_path)
+ exit_code = _GENERATOR.main(["--release"])
+ assert exit_code == 0
+ assert _GENERATOR.collect_fragments(tmp_path) == []
+
+
+def test_main_without_release_leaves_fragments_in_place(tmp_path, monkeypatch, capsys):
+ _write_fragment(tmp_path, "0010-a.rst", "[change]\nanchor=a\nheading=A\ncontext=a")
+ monkeypatch.setattr(_GENERATOR, "_CHANGES_DIR", tmp_path)
+ exit_code = _GENERATOR.main([])
+ captured = capsys.readouterr()
+ assert exit_code == 0
+ assert "A" in captured.out
+ assert len(_GENERATOR.collect_fragments(tmp_path)) == 1
+
+
+def test_committed_changes_directory_fragments_all_parse():
+ changes_dir = _REPO_ROOT / "changes"
+ for fragment_path in _GENERATOR.collect_fragments(changes_dir):
+ rendered = _GENERATOR.render_fragment(fragment_path)
+ assert rendered.strip() != ""

+"""Tests for the public-surface snapshot tool in ``tools/surface.py``."""
+
+import importlib.util
+from pathlib import Path
+
+_REPO_ROOT = Path(__file__).parent.parent.parent
+_TOOL_PATH = _REPO_ROOT / "tools" / "surface.py"
+_SURFACE_PATH = _REPO_ROOT / ".public-surface"
+
+
+def _load_tool():
+ spec = importlib.util.spec_from_file_location("edify_surface_tool", _TOOL_PATH)
+ assert spec is not None
+ assert spec.loader is not None
+ module = importlib.util.module_from_spec(spec)
+ spec.loader.exec_module(module)
+ return module
+
+
+_TOOL = _load_tool()
+
+
+def test_committed_surface_file_exists_and_is_non_empty():
+ assert _SURFACE_PATH.exists()
+ assert _SURFACE_PATH.read_text(encoding="utf-8").strip() != ""
+
+
+def test_computed_surface_matches_the_committed_snapshot():
+ computed = _TOOL.compute_surface()
+ committed = _SURFACE_PATH.read_text(encoding="utf-8")
+ assert computed == committed, (
+ "public surface drift: run `python tools/surface.py --write` and commit "
+ ".public-surface with a changes/ fragment describing the change."
+ )
+
+
+def test_surface_lists_the_core_public_symbols():
+ computed = _TOOL.compute_surface()
+ assert "edify.Pattern" in computed
+ assert "edify.RegexBuilder" in computed
+ assert "edify.Regex" in computed
+ assert "edify.EdifyError" in computed
+
+
+def test_surface_excludes_private_module_paths():
+ computed = _TOOL.compute_surface()
+ for line in computed.splitlines():
+ dotted = line.split("(")[0]
+ parts = dotted.split(".")
+ assert not any(part.startswith("_") for part in parts[:-1]), (
+ f"surface line leaks a private module path: {line!r}"
+ )
+
+
+def test_surface_is_sorted_and_deduplicated():
+ computed = _TOOL.compute_surface()
+ lines = computed.splitlines()
+ assert lines == sorted(lines)
+ assert len(lines) == len(set(lines))
+
+
+def test_check_returns_zero_when_surface_matches(capsys):
+ exit_code = _TOOL.main(["--check"])
+ assert exit_code == 0
+
+
+def test_check_returns_one_when_surface_drifts(tmp_path, monkeypatch, capsys):
+ drifted_snapshot = tmp_path / ".public-surface"
+ drifted_snapshot.write_text("edify.SomethingRemoved\n", encoding="utf-8")
+ monkeypatch.setattr(_TOOL, "_SURFACE_PATH", drifted_snapshot)
+ exit_code = _TOOL.main(["--check"])
+ captured = capsys.readouterr()
+ assert exit_code == 1
+ assert "public surface drift" in captured.err
+
+
+def test_write_overwrites_the_snapshot_file(tmp_path, monkeypatch):
+ target = tmp_path / ".public-surface"
+ monkeypatch.setattr(_TOOL, "_SURFACE_PATH", target)
+ exit_code = _TOOL.main(["--write"])
+ assert exit_code == 0
+ assert target.read_text(encoding="utf-8") == _TOOL.compute_surface()
+
+
+def test_bare_invocation_prints_the_surface_to_stdout(capsys):
+ exit_code = _TOOL.main([])
+ captured = capsys.readouterr()
+ assert exit_code == 0
+ assert "edify.Pattern" in captured.out
